Specific Procurement Notice Template Request for Bids Non-Consulting Services Employer: Ministry of Communication, Digital Technology and Innovation Project: Ghana Digital Accelerated Project Contract title: Last-mile Connectivity to Selected Unserved and Underserved Areas and Rural Community Information Centers (CICs) Country: Republic of Ghana Credit No. IDA 70960-GH RFB No: GDAP/COMP1.2.1 - GH-MOCDTI-488850-NC-RFB Issued on: 22nd May, 2026 1. The Government of the Republic of Ghana has received financing from the World Bank toward the cost of the Ghana Digital Acceleration Project (GDAP), and intends to apply part of the proceeds toward payments under the contract FOR LAST-MILE CONNECTIVITY TO SELECTED UNSERVED AND UNDERSERVED AREAS AND RURAL COMMUNITY INFORMATION CENTERS (CICS). For this contract, the Borrower shall process the payments using the Direct Payment disbursement method, as defined in the World Bank’s Disbursement Guidelines for Investment Project Financing.” 2. The Ministry of Communication, Digital Technology and Innovations (MoCDTI) now invites sealed Bids from eligible Bidders for the following. |

No. |

Description |

Bid Security |

1 |

Last-mile connectivity to selected unserved areas and rural Community Information Centers (CICs) |

2% of the Bid Price in Bank Guarantee format. 3. Bidding will be conducted through international competitive procurement using a Request for Bids (RFB) as specified in the World Bank’s “Procurement Regulations for IPF Borrowers -” September 2025, 7th Edition (“Procurement Regulations”) and is open to all eligible Bidders (or only to prequalified Bidders as the case may be) as defined in the Procurement Regulations. 4. Bids will be evaluated in accordance with the evaluation process set out in the bidding documents. The following weightings shall apply for Rated Criteria (including technical and non-price factors): 70% and for Bid cost: 30%. 5. Interested eligible Bidders may obtain further information from the address below and inspect the bidding document during office hours 0900 to 1700 at the address given below. 6. The bidding document in English may be purchased by interested eligible Bidders upon the submission of a written application to the address below and upon payment of a nonrefundable fee of GH₵2,000.00. The method of payment will be cash or bank draft in the name of the Ministry of Communication, Digital Technology and Innovations. The document will be sent by either email, courier or pickup. Cost of courier service shall be borne by prospective bidder. 7. Bids must be delivered to the address below on or before 10:00GMT 3rd July, 2026. Electronic Bidding will not be permitted. Late Bids will be rejected. The outer Bid envelopes marked “ORIGINAL BID”, and the inner envelopes marked “TECHNICAL PART” will be publicly opened in the presence of the Bidders’ designated representatives and anyone who chooses to attend, at the address below at 10:00GMT on 3rd July, 2026. All envelopes marked “FINANCIAL PART” shall remain unopened and will be held in safe custody of the Employer until the second public Bid opening. 8. All Bids must be accompanied by a Bid Security in the amount of 2% of the bid price in the currency of the bid in a Bank Guarantee format. 9. Attention is drawn to the Procurement Regulations requiring the Borrower to disclose information on the successful bidder’s beneficial ownership, as part of the Contract Award Notice, using the Beneficial Ownership Disclosure Form as included in the bidding document. 10.
